REAL TIME DIGITAL PHASE SHIFTERS UTILIZING 4-PORT SINGLE-JUNCTION LATCHING CIRCULATORS.
Abstract
The devices under development are real-time-delay digital phase shifters utilizing 4-port single-junction waveguide latching circulators. Ferrimagnetic material parameters as applied to this program are discussed. A theoretical investigation of the time delay equalization problem is outlined. Phase dispersion measurement techniques which will be used on this program are also discussed. A systematic experimental investigation of the mode excitation model developed in X band and scaled to C band is also described, and empirical data presented. In X band the dielectric ring model is giving best performance. In C band the dielectric-button model is being used. To date, the broadest bandwidth in the desired operating region has been obtained with the C band unit. (Author)
